Weak Cover Letter Summary Examples
- Eager to gain experience in the automotive design field.
- Committed to learning and growing within a team-oriented environment.
Why this is Weak:
- Lack of Specificity: The statements above fail to specify what unique skills or experiences the candidate brings to the role. Candidates should elaborate on their technical expertise or prior projects related to mechanical design.
- Absence of Value Proposition: These examples do not clearly communicate the value the candidate would add to the company. A strong cover letter summary should highlight what the candidate can contribute, rather than simply stating a desire to grow.
- Generic Language: Using phrases like "committed to learning" can come off as cliché. Candidates should strive for language that sets them apart and demonstrates real enthusiasm for the role.
- Missing Industry Knowledge: Applicants should indicate familiarity with industry trends or technologies relevant to mechanical design in automotive. This understanding shows proactive interest and preparation for the position.
- No Mention of Achievements: The summaries do not reference any specific accomplishments or prior experiences. Including measurable achievements could make a significant impact and provide a clearer picture of the candidate's capabilities.

Weak Cover Letter Work Experiences Examples
Weak Cover Letter Work Experience Examples for Mechanical Design in Automotive
Internship at Local Auto Repair Shop
During my summer internship at a local auto repair shop, I assisted technicians with basic tasks, such as washing vehicles and organizing tools. I learned some terminology related to automotive components.Part-Time Job at a Parts Store
I worked part-time at an automotive parts store, where my responsibilities included putting away inventory and helping customers find basic parts. I occasionally read product manuals and specifications.Project in a Group Class Assignment
In my senior design class, I collaborated with classmates on a project to redesign a bicycle frame. I contributed by sketching ideas and preparing a presentation, though I did not lead any specific tasks.
Why These Are Weak Work Experiences
Lack of Relevant Skills Application: The internship at the auto repair shop primarily involved menial tasks, which do not showcase any relevant skills or experiences in mechanical design. Effective cover letters should highlight specific skills and hands-on experiences that relate directly to the job.
Limited Impact on Professional Development: The part-time job at the parts store does not offer any real opportunities for growth in engineering or design. It lacks technical involvement and does not demonstrate an understanding of mechanical design processes pertinent to the automotive industry.
Minimal Individual Contribution: The group project in class, while a cooperative effort, shows a lack of initiative and leadership from the candidate. Employers often look for individuals who take charge and demonstrate problem-solving skills, rather than showcasing a passive role in a team effort without distinct contributions.
